Tanker owners will probably have to write 2022 off as merely ‘transitional’, according to French shipbroker Barry Rogliano Salles (BRS).

The company said in its latest market report that a sustained recovery for the suffering sector may not come until 2023, unless vessel scrapping sees a dramatic upturn.

The Paris-based shop does not see this as likely, however.

BRS said that as the fleet continues to grow, demand for ships will lag pre-pandemic levels across 2022.
